Aspiration Training is delighted to announce that from February 2021, we are doubling the size of our traineeship programme in Birmingham and bringing our successful traineeship programme to Gloucester. . 

Traineeship programmes help young people who want to access an apprenticeship or job, but who don’t yet have the appropriate skills or experience. Ove75% of young people who attend the programme go on to a job or further education. 

Our traineeship programme consists of three components: work preparation training, a work experience placement and support with English and maths if required. This is all provided by our specialist teams who give the right careers advice and support to help young people into work.  

Traineeships primarily support 16–24-year-olds who:  

  • Are unemployed 
  • Have little to no work experience 
  • Have the potential to go into employment or an apprenticeship within 12 months 

We are expanding our centre in Digbeth and will be opening a centre in central Gloucester through our established working relationship with Gloucestershire County Council, although our training is predominantly delivered remotely, and we can even support with IT equipment if needed. 

Aspiration Training have a great network of employers to support work placements including reputable businesses across Health & Social Care, Childcare, Dental and Business Services sectors and beyond. We have been delivering apprenticeships in the local area for over 10 years.
